A psychiatrist examines how the world's four most important mind-altering substances— alcohol, cocaine, nicotine, and opiates—have played a significant role throughout human history, and explains how these powerful drugs affect the brain and cause addiction.

• Presents a historical review of four plant-derived drugs—alcohol, cocaine, nicotine, and opiates—and their effects throughout human civilization, as well as a fascinating exploration of the mystery and misery of addiction

• Provides comprehensive explanations of medical and psychiatric effects of these drugs

• Supplies stories of people who made discoveries about these drugs or who had their lives altered by them

• Describes the discovery of the way in which the brain works

• Includes illustrations of brain pathways and of the four plants of origin for these drugs, and maps showing drug trade triangles
